Pack Essentials

Prepare a “go bag” with the following items:

For Children:

  • Diapers, formula, bottles, and wipes
  • Favorite comfort items (blanket, toy)
  • Copies of important documents (birth certificate, immunization records)

For Elderly Individuals:

  • Prescriptions and medical equipment (e.g., walkers, oxygen tanks)
  • Emergency contacts and medical information
  • Sturdy footwear and personal hygiene items

For Pets:

  • Food, water, and bowls
  • Leashes, carriers, and bedding
  • Vaccination records and identification tags

Disaster Distress Helpline

  • The Disaster Distress Helpline (DDH) is the first national hotline dedicated to providing year-round disaster crisis counseling. This toll-free, multilingual, crisis support service is available 24/7 to all residents in the U.S. and its territories who are experiencing emotional distress related to natural or human-caused disasters. Call or text 1-800-985-5990.
